Karl F. Schmidt

February 26, 1937 — April 9, 2016

Karl F. Schmidt, 79, of Exeter Township passed away Saturday April 9, 2016 in the Reading Hospital and Medical Center. He was the husband of Sharon Laury Schmidt. Born in Pottstown, Karl was the son of the late Hugh R. and M. Katharine (Clements) Schmidt. Karl is survived by his sister- in - law, Sheila L. Benton and her husband, Ray Benton of San Diego, California as well as their children, Megan and Eric. Karl attended public schools in Schwenksville, PA and upon high school graduation he earned his Bachelors Degree in Music Education from Lebanon Valley College.
Karl began studying the piano at the age of 4 and the pipe organ at 9 years of age. When Karl was 13 he played a recital on the famous Wanamaker organ in Philadelphia. In his early teens he began his 50 years of musical service as a church organist and choir director. Karl taught for a short period of time in the Reading School District. Karl retired from the Exeter School District after many years of teaching general music classes and conducting choral groups on the secondary level. Karl was privileged to play many times for the late Fred Waring. He also enjoyed working at Hershey Park for Music in the Parks. Karl's exceptional keyboard ability created many opportunities to travel throughout the United States playing for different music publishing companies, choral reading sessions and for many world-renown composers.
Karl was a member of Atonement Lutheran Church in Wyomissing as well as an associate member of Emmanuel Lutheran Church in Naples, FL.
